Accessory Apartments: Scheff distributed a revised LIP Units Only Application for the affordable accessory apartment program. She noted that she has never received comments from DHCD on a draft sent in March 2005. This is the “final” version.
HOME Agreement: The HOME agreement for the Greenridge condominium has been revised to meet HOME requirements. The Lincoln Foundation has been designated as the Town’s agent.
Lincoln Foundation: Scheff commented that we should explore what is required to have the Lincoln Foundation assume the official role of a Housing Partnership with the Town.
CHODA: Scheff also noted that Lincoln is part of the Waltham CHODA. Perhaps this agency could function as a non-profit developer to assist with the Sunnyside project? She will follow up.
Sunnyside Apartment: Sam Rappaport joined the meeting and presented elevations for the proposed apartment addition to 30 Sunnyside. The proposed apartment is 746 sq. ft.
The size of the residence must be determined to establish the ratio. Should the existing plan be drawn to show decks? It is not yet clear where the best parking access for the apartment should be. Putting it on the same lot means either a long walk or breaking up the front yard. Using the adjacent lot might be better. Wolf will follow up on the permiting procedure with Mark Whitehead toward Planning Board and ZBA approvals.
